American Weldquip introduces the HRT - HEAT RESISTANT TECHNOLOGY Xtra Long Life contact tips that are proven to outlast standard C12200 Copper and Copper Chrome Zirconium Contact Tips.

The HRT contact tips provide the ideal combination of hardness, conductivity and high temperature stability.   The special tip material formulation maintains its hardness at elevated temperatures thus offering superior wear characteristics and electrical conductivity.

What is HRT - Heat Resistant Technology

Heat generated from the welding process is a major influence affecting your contact tip life.   This heat tends to anneal and soften the copper tip material thus increasing the weld wire abrasion, micro arcing, and decreased conductivity on the ID bore causing premature tip failure.    The higher the operating temperature the worse the performance.  Different tip material formulations, such as Copper Chrome Zirconium, have been used over the years to increase hardness and help improve tip life.  While the introduction of different tip materials may improve wear resistance in certain applications, the harder material with a higher annealing temperature sacrifices electrical conductivity which can lead to poor arc starting characteristics.

The NEW American Weldquip HRT contact tips are engineered to provide unsurpassed resistance to annealing at high operating temperatures while maintaining excellent electrical conductivity. 

 The outer shell of the tip is made from highly conductive copper for superior electrical conductivity.

 The inside diameter is comprised of mechanically alloyed copper based compounds.  These special copper based composite materials provide a stable microstructure at elevated operating temperatures guaranteeing the high hardness, wear resistance and high electrical conductivity.

The tip material is then produced by cold pressing the outer highly conductive copper and the inside diameter composite material.    The final finished copper rod is then mandrel extruded to insure a finished tip with excellent ID surface finish and concentricity.
